Ballroom dance consists of two main branches:

1. American Style Ballroom Dance
2. International-style ballroom dancing

American ballroom dancing is made up of two subcategories. Those two categories are American Style Smooth and American Style Rhythm. American Style Smooth is made up of waltz, tango, foxtrot and Viennese waltz. American Style Rhythm is made up of Rumba, East Coast Swing, Cha Cha, Bolero and Mambo

International ballroom dance is made up of international standard and international latin. The international standard is Waltz, Tango, Foxtrot, Viennese Waltz and Quickstep. International Style Latin is made up of Rumba, Cha Cha, Samba, Paso Doble and Jive.

A large percentage of the techniques and figures overlap from International Style dance to American Style dance. On a social level, a good follower should be able to follow International Style figures even if they are trained in the American Style, and a good International Style dancer should be able to follow American Style figures even if they are trained in the International Style.

In the competitive world, international style dance is more popular all over the world. What is considered the championship of ballroom and Latin dances, is held in Blackpool England every year and is held in International Style Dancing.

If you’re learning to dance for social reasons, you’ll want to learn other dances that are outside the scope of traditional ballroom dancing. Those dances are salsa, merengue, bachata, and West Coast swing. In the US, those 4 dances have become extremely popular and are essential to learn if you are interested in learning social dancing. Within the American social ballroom world, two of the most commonly performed dances within the traditional ballroom are the Waltz, Tango, Rumba, East Coast Swing, and Cha Cha. If you’re interested in learning to dance, you’ll want to figure out your goals. If your goal is to go out dancing at a local Latin dance club, you will want to learn Salsa, Merengue, Bachata.
